Miss Anambra sex tape: Arrest Chidinma, make her face 14 years in prison – Pageant Association tasks police

Although the Police has debunked reports it arrested a group of men allegedly behind the leaked lesbian sex video of former Miss Anambra, Chidinma Okeke, the Association of Beauty Pageant and Fashion Exhibition Organization of Nigeria, ABPFEON, has called for an investigation into the issue.

Reports made the rounds on Thursday that the 7-man gang was apprehended in Enugu.

A Facebook user, Martin Beck Nworah, had said the police arrested the guys at ‘Enugu’.

He posted some pictures of the alleged suspects and wrote: “The guys are allegedly part of a 7-member gang who specialize in blackmailing ladies, especially UNIZIK students.

“They are allegedly the guys who leaked the viral lesbian sex video of ex-Miss Anambra, Chidinma Okeke.”‎

But the Enugu State Police spokesperson, Ebere Armaraizu, had debunked the claim, saying, “I’m not aware of this. No, no, no! No arrest of such was made in Enugu.

“I’m in the Command and if anything like that happened, I should know and make it available,” he told DAILY POST.

Also, the Commissioner of Police, CP in Anambra, Mr Sam Okaula, dismissed the report, saying the command was not aware of any sex scandal involving the former beauty queen.

Following the police’s comment, the ABPFEON made its stand known, insisting that the ex-beauty queen must be made to face the law.

In a statement signed by the Secretary General, Alex Nwankw‎o, the association said, “If Nigeria Police were really interested in this case, the actual culprit who is Chidinma Okeke should be looked for.
